'16 Grand Design 313RLTS offer.....?

So, my DW and I have been casually looking for a TT and things have progressed a bit lately. THe biggest hang up has been storage of the TT as we don't have space at our home. Many of you know the high cost of trailer storage in SoCal. It not, it is very high. Anyways, it looks like we may have a connection to a spot close by that is very cheap and easily accessed.

With this new news we have looked a bit harder at trailers. WE have concluded that the Grand Design 313RLTS has about the best features combined with quality and customer service that we have found (ORV as well but no deals currently found). We came across this gem at one of our local dealers. It is one of their left-over 2016 units that is a new unit.

Question: This unit is currently sitting at about 12% off MSRP. This dealer has a good handful of other 2017 units sitting. 20% off MSRP would be about $36.7K. This unit seems to have all the standard features but no major optional equipment that would command a higher price close to MSRP compared to other units. If you were to go in and make an offer what would it be knowing the facts you have in the link below? I have no problem negotiating and even low balling to see were their starting point is but TT are new to me.

My first inclination is to offer about $32K and see what they do. Thoughts?

With it being a left-over I'd start at 36% off of MSRP and not go over 32% off. It may take them a couple of months but they'll come around. It's a left-over and they apparently don't have people lined up to buy it. Every day it sits on their lot is costing them money... Good luck.
